Nucleus has launched a new CPD learning zone for advisers and paraplanners across all of its propositions.
The hub provides Chartered Insurance Institute (CII)-certified learning materials, giving users on-demand access to refresh planning knowledge, explore technical topics and keep pace with regulatory change at their convenience.
Content includes exclusive webinars and recordings from live events delivered by Nucleus’ in-house technical experts.
CPD certificates are issued on completion, enabling advisers to track progress. The resource is available via the Illuminate Tech section of the Nucleus website.
Structured modules cover areas such as ‘An adviser’s guide to taxation of trusts’ and ‘Adding value to clients through effective planning’.
A new series will provide analysis and updates in the run-up to the 2025 Autumn Budget, including commentary on proposals from chancellor Rachel Reeves and their implications for financial planning.
